Ofsted Insights

What This School Does Well

Elmy Hall School is specifically designed to support pupils with special educational needs and disabilities with experienced leaders who know how to adapt teaching to meet individual needs. The school offers a broad curriculum combined with strong support for personal development, including phonics training for pupils at early stages of reading and tailored behaviour and learning plans. Parents can be confident in the school's comprehensive safeguarding procedures and strong health and safety systems.

Key Strengths

  • Experienced leadership team with significant expertise in special educational needs - existing schools in the group have all been judged successful at recent Ofsted inspections
  • Well-designed curriculum tailored to pupils with SEND, including phonics training for all staff and personalised learning plans
  • Strong safeguarding procedures with trained designated safeguarding leads and clear recruitment processes
  • Ambitious plans for personal and social development including age-appropriate PSHE teaching and British values education
  • Appropriate supervision ratios and comprehensive health and safety policies including fire safety compliance

Safeguarding

Safeguarding is effective with well-established recruitment processes, mandatory staff training, clear procedures for reporting and monitoring welfare concerns, and trained designated safeguarding leads supported by a head of safeguarding.

Elmy Hall School is a proposed independent special school that is likely to meet all independent school standards if registered. The proprietor has a proven track record in leading successful independent special schools with strong systems in place to ensure consistent standards.
